Looking at Islamic Center Debate, World Sees U.S.- By Thanassis Cambanis (The New York Times)

For more than two decades, Abdelhamid Shaari has been lobbying a succession of governments in Milan for permission to build a mosque for his congregants — any mosque at all, in any location. To Mr Shaari, the furor over the precise location of Park51, the proposed Islamic community center in Lower Manhattan, looks like something to aspire to. “At least in America,” he says, “there’s a debate” ... read more
